Why Post-Production Studios Are Going Back to Tape

Send us Fan Mail [https://www.buzzsprout.com/2536826/fan_mail/new] Ray Quattromini of Fortuna Data is joined by David Fox from JPY, the UK distributor for Archiware, for a deep dive into one of the most underappreciated areas of IT: data archiving, backup, and long-term storage management.  David has been in the industry since the early 90s, starting out in pre-press and desktop publishing before migrating into the world of audio, video, and media storage. Today, he helps organisations across media & entertainment, law enforcement, universities, and enterprise manage and protect their data using Archiware's P5 software a powerful backup, archive, and replication platform that works across LTO tape, cloud, and a wide range of storage hardware.  In this episode, they cover: -  - The difference between backup and archive and why both matter  - Hot vs cold storage and why media companies are constantly running out of space  - How P5 handles LTO tape migration (LTO 8/9 to LTO 10) without losing your index - CCTV and law enforcement use cases, including 90-day retention compliance  - Why LTO tape is making a comeback especially for AI training data  - The real cost of cloud storage vs on-prem tape  - Immutable backups and ransomware protection using S3 object storage  - Data sovereignty concerns and the shift back to on-prem solutions  - New features in Archiware P5 v8: EDL restore for video editors  - How P5 is licensed and what that means for your infrastructure Whether you're in post-production, IT, or just trying to figure out where to put all your data this episode is packed with practical insight.  Find out more about Archiware: www.archiware.com  Find out more about Fortuna Data: www.fortunadata.com

Why the US Cloud Act Is a Threat to Your Data

Send us Fan Mail [https://www.buzzsprout.com/2536826/fan_mail/new] In this episode, Ray Quattromini speaks with Richard Howson, UK Channel Manager at Impossible Cloud, about one of the most overlooked risks in enterprise storage the US Cloud Act. Richard explains why simply storing data in the UK isn't enough if you're using a US-based cloud provider, and how true data sovereignty requires knowing where your data lives, who has legal access to it, and how it's protected. They also dig into the real cost of hyperscaler storage, the growing demand for UK sovereign solutions across all sectors, and how Impossible Cloud is positioning itself as the go-to object storage layer in a multi-cloud world. A must-listen for MSPs, resellers and IT leaders navigating data compliance and cloud cost control. What Cost per GB Doesn’t Tell You About Long-Term Costs

Send us Fan Mail [https://www.buzzsprout.com/2536826/fan_mail/new] Is your storage strategy built for the future or setting your business up for failure? In this episode of the Fortuna Data Podcast, Ray Quattromini sits down with Matteo from Kingston Technology to break down what IT leaders, CIOs, and infrastructure decision-makers need to understand about modern storage. With data growing faster than most organisations can control, and AI workloads driving unprecedented demand, the wrong storage decisions today can lead to higher costs, downtime, and long-term risk. This conversation covers: How to choose the right SSD, NVMe, or memory for your workload Why total cost of ownership (TCO) matters more than cost per GB The real differences between SLC, MLC, TLC, and QLC NAND How AI is reshaping infrastructure and driving on-premise demand The hidden risks of cheap storage decisions Why storage is now a board-level conversation (not just IT) You’ll also gain insight into enterprise storage reliability, endurance, and performance trade-offs, plus what’s coming next in storage architecture, including PCIe Gen5 and composable infrastructure.
